			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>1. Found out that dreams really do come true—at the Cumberland Pencil Museum!</p>
<p>Replica graphite mine! Old pencils! New pencils! Pencil-making machines! World&#8217;s largest pencil!</p>
<p>The best part was the secret WWII pencil: regular type pencils squirreled away from the factory under cover of darkness so that they could be hollowed out and have one of four tiny maps of Germany inserted. A compass was added under the metal piece that holds on the eraser, and then the pencils were distributed to RAF pilots in case they were shot down over Germany.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>1. Halloween is just coming into vogue in the UK; we got a single trick-and/or-treater whom we duly ignored. Bah, humbug!</p>
<p>2. Instead, we wholeheartedly embrace Bonfire Night. Technically the 5th of November (as in, &#8220;remember, remember the&#8221;), but aside from a few fireworks last night, the celebrations tend to be moved to the weekend before or after. We&#8217;re looking forward to our first potential effigy burning (apparently, this is beginning to fall out of favor) on the 8th.</p>
<p>3. U.S. Election Day. Marking the end of making excuses for and/or avoiding the topic of our President. At least until January 20—until then, Obama can do no wrong. It was pretty frustrating waiting for all you Americans to actually roll out of bed and vote, though, and then I had to stay up until 4 a.m. to learn the results.</p>
<p>4. Poppy Day (aka Remembrance Day, Armistice Day, Veterans Day). It seems to be a much more visible commemoration here, and I find the poppy emblem already appearing everywhere to be both meaningful and aesthetically pleasing.</p>
